tin giraffe: Fawley, St Mary the Virgin. John Piper
tin giraffe: Fawley, St Mary the Virgin. John Piper
tin giraffe: Fawley, St Mary the Virgin. John Piper
tin giraffe: Fawley, St Mary the Virgin. John Piper
tin giraffe: Fawley, St Mary the Virgin. John Piper